At times, when checkpointed sandbox from store cannot be cleaned up properly we still retain the sandbox in both the store and in memory. But this sandbox store may not contain important configuration information from docker. So when docker requests a new sandbox, instead of using it as is, reconcile the sandbox state from store with the the configuration information provided by docker. To do this mark the sandbox from store as stub and never reveal it to external searches. When docker requests a new sandbox, update the stub sandbox and clear the stub flag.
